POWER SUNVISORS
- Optional
The powered sunvisors are controlled by
switches on the driver and passenger armrest
panels. The driver side contains switches for both
sides to allow driver control. The passenger side
has a switch only for the passenger side visor.
Press and hold DOWN side of the switch to
extend, then release at the desired position. Press
and hold UP side of the switch to retract the visor.
NOTE: Do not position visors where they will
impair the driver’s forward vision or side
mirror view.
BRAKE-SHIFT INTERLOCK
Workhorse and Ford chassis are equipped
with a brake-shift interlock safety feature. The
shift lever cannot be moved from the Park
position unless the ignition is ON and the service
brake pedal is pressed.
NOTE: On Ford chassis, if the brake light fuse is
blown, the interlock feature will not work
properly and an alternate method must
be used. See your Ford Owners Guide for
detailed instructions on what to do in this
situation.
